<TABLE>
                                                                  FORM 13F INFORMATION TABLE
                                                           VALUE   SHARES/  SH/ PUT/ INVSTMT    OTHER          VOTING AUTHORITY
        NAME OF ISSUER          TITLE OF CLASS    CUSIP   (x$1000) PRN AMT  PRN CALL DSCRETN   MANAGERS     SOLE    SHARED    NONE
------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------
<S>                            <C>              <C>       <C>      <C>      <C> <C>  <C>     <C>          <C>      <C>      <C>
ABB Ltd SP ADR                 COM              000375204      241    10600 SH       Sole                    10600
Abraxas Petroleum              COM              003830106       37    16000 SH       Sole                    16000
Alerian MLP                    COM              00162Q866    12265   692162 SH       Sole                   692162
Allstate Corp                  COM              020002101     1676    34154 SH       Sole                    34154
Altria Grp                     COM              02209S103      691    20107 SH       Sole                    20107
American Elec Power            COM              025537101      321     6601 SH       Sole                     6601
American Express               COM              025816109      556     8241 SH       Sole                     8241
Ameriprise Finl Inc            COM              03076C106     7082    96163 SH       Sole                    96163
Amgen Inc                      COM              031162100     3468    33835 SH       Sole                    33835
Apple Computer Inc             COM              037833100      928     2097 SH       Sole                     2097
AT&T Inc                       COM              00206R102      483    13170 SH       Sole                    13170
Automatic Data                 COM              053015103     4130    63508 SH       Sole                    63508
Barclays S&P 500 Veqtor        COM              06740C337    29535   218376 SH       Sole                   218376
Beam Inc                       COM              073730103      343     5400 SH       Sole                     5400
Becton Dickinson & Co          COM              075887109    12102   126580 SH       Sole                   126580
Berkshire Hath/B               COM              084670702      470     4508 SH       Sole                     4508
Bristol-Myers Squibb           COM              110122108      562    13646 SH       Sole                    13646
Caterpillar Inc                COM              149123101      763     8778 SH       Sole                     8778
Cerner Corp                    COM              156782104     1245    13141 SH       Sole                    13141
Chevron Corp                   COM              166764100     2268    19084 SH       Sole                    19084
Cigna Corp                     COM              125509109      337     5400 SH       Sole                     5400
Cisco Systems                  COM              17275R102    21729  1039926 SH       Sole                  1039926
Coca Cola                      COM              191216100      582    14391 SH       Sole                    14391
Colgate-Palmolive              COM              194162103     2394    20279 SH       Sole                    20279
Commerce Bancshares            COM              200525103      335     8202 SH       Sole                     8202
CVS Caremark Corp              COM              126650100     6947   126327 SH       Sole                   126327
Deere & Co                     COM              244199105     6669    77564 SH       Sole                    77564
Discover Finl Svcs             COM              254709108      696    15526 SH       Sole                    15526
Duke Energy Corp               COM              26441C204      266     3666 SH       Sole                     3666
EMC Corp                       COM              268648102    10155   425076 SH       Sole                   425076
Emerson Electric               COM              291011104      670    12000 SH       Sole                    12000
Enterprise Prods Partners LP   COM              293792107      374     6200 SH       Sole                     6200
Exxon Mobil Corp               COM              30231G102     4119    45712 SH       Sole                    45712
Fifth Third Bancorp            COM              316773100     7029   430959 SH       Sole                   430959
Fortune Brands Home & Security COM              34964C106      202     5400 SH       Sole                     5400
Freeport-McMoran CL B          COM              35671d857     6114   184708 SH       Sole                   184708
General Electric Co            COM              369604103      686    29660 SH       Sole                    29660
Gilead Sciences Inc            COM              375558103     8340   170404 SH       Sole                   170404
Google Inc                     COM              38259P508    13176    16590 SH       Sole                    16590
Guggenheim S&P 500 Equal Weigh COM              78355W106     3966    66493 SH       Sole                    66493
H. J. Heinz                    COM              423074103      276     3817 SH       Sole                     3817
Highwoods Properties           COM              431284108     4957   125262 SH       Sole                   125262
Hilltop Holdings               COM                             298    22064 SH       Sole                    22064
Hollyfrontier Corp             COM              436106108     6969   135445 SH       Sole                   135445
Home Depot Inc                 COM              437076102     1187    17009 SH       Sole                    17009
Honeywell Inc                  COM              438516106      868    11525 SH       Sole                    11525
Inergy LP                      COM              456615103      993    48600 SH       Sole                    48600
Int'l Business Mach            COM              459200101     1187     5566 SH       Sole                     5566
Intel Corp                     COM              458140100    13070   598578 SH       Sole                   598578
J P Morgan Chase               COM              46625h100      292     6154 SH       Sole                     6154
Jack Henry & Assoc             COM              426281101     2380    51500 SH       Sole                    51500
Johnson & Johnson              COM              478160104    12054   147841 SH       Sole                   147841
Kimberly-Clark                 COM              494368103      265     2700 SH       Sole                     2700
Kinder Morgan Energy Ut LP     COM              494550106      206     2300 SH       Sole                     2300
Laboratory Corp of America     COM              50540R409      722     8000 SH       Sole                     8000
Lockheed Martin Corp           COM              539830109     8513    88200 SH       Sole                    88200
Mastercard                     COM              57636q104     6710    12400 SH       Sole                    12400
McDonald's Corp                COM              580135101      526     5272 SH       Sole                     5272
Medtronic Inc                  COM              585055106      634    13500 SH       Sole                    13500
Merck & Co                     COM              58933Y105      335     7571 SH       Sole                     7571
Microsoft Corp                 COM              594918104    10811   377940 SH       Sole                   377940
Monmouth REIT Cl A             COM              609720107      146    13080 SH       Sole                    13080
Natl Oilwell Varco             COM              637071101    12307   173953 SH       Sole                   173953
NextEra Energy Inc             COM              65339F101      498     6409 SH       Sole                     6409
Opko Health Inc                COM              68375N103      763   100000 SH       Sole                   100000
Oracle Corp                    COM              68389X105    18360   567887 SH       Sole                   567887
Paccar Inc                     COM              693718108      758    15000 SH       Sole                    15000
Parker Hannifin Corp           COM              701094104      412     4500 SH       Sole                     4500
Paychex Inc                    COM              704326107      532    15187 SH       Sole                    15187
Pepsico Inc                    COM              713448108     6216    78575 SH       Sole                    78575
Pfizer Inc                     COM              717081103      931    32272 SH       Sole                    32272
Philip Morris Intl             COM              718172109     2621    28270 SH       Sole                    28270
Praxair Inc                    COM              74005P104      549     4920 SH       Sole                     4920
Procter & Gamble               COM              742718109    12991   168582 SH       Sole                   168582
Qualcomm Inc                   COM              747525103    12394   185149 SH       Sole                   185149
Schlumberger Ltd               COM              806857108      760    10150 SH       Sole                    10150
Sempra Energy                  COM              816851109      516     6452 SH       Sole                     6452
Silvermet Inc                  COM              828425108        7    80000 SH       Sole                    80000
SPDR Index Shs Fds Asia Pacif  COM              78463X301     7857   102995 SH       Sole                   102995
SPDR Index Shs Fds S&P World E COM              78463x889     7760   295610 SH       Sole                   295610
SPDR Tech Sel                  COM              81369Y803      297     9824 SH       Sole                     9824
Sprint Nextel Corp             COM              852061100       65    10434 SH       Sole                    10434
Suburban Propane LP            COM              864482104     1090    24484 SH       Sole                    24484
Target Corp                    COM              87612e106      495     7225 SH       Sole                     7225
Thermo Fisher Scientific       COM              883556102     9265   121122 SH       Sole                   121122
Toronto Dominion Bk            COM              891160509      365     4380 SH       Sole                     4380
United Tech                    COM              913017109     1267    13558 SH       Sole                    13558
US Bancorp New                 COM              902973304     2033    59930 SH       Sole                    59930
Vanguard Emerg Mkts ETF        COM              922042858      599    13962 SH       Sole                    13962
Verizon Commun Inc             COM              92343V104      214     4350 SH       Sole                     4350
Walgreen                       COM              931422109      572    12000 SH       Sole                    12000
Wits Basin Prec Minrls         COM              977427103        1    25000 SH       Sole                    25000
Columbia Fds Ser Tr Midcap     MUT              19765J608     1305    97495 SH       Sole                    97495
Columbia Ser Tr Sml Cap Indx Z MUT              19765J814      243    12221 SH       Sole                    12221
Federated Strategic Value Cl I MUT              314172560       75    13799 SH       Sole                    13799
Harbor Intl                    MUT              411511306     1030    16234 SH       Sole                    16234
Thornburg Invt Tr Global Value MUT              885215566     1002    34912 SH       Sole                    34912
</TABLE>